Onboarding

When a customer sets up a project, their brief arrives in Onboarding. You review each brief and decide whether it can go ahead, then organize the validated ones — setting the plan, hosting and features — and launch the project so it's commissioned. Open Onboarding to start.

Before you start — You need an administrator account. A brief flows through stages: the customer submits it, you validate it, you organize it (plan, hosting, features), then you launch it. The customer fills their own parts — the brief, their region, their domain and the terms; you set the plan, the hosting and the feature list.

Review the onboarding queue

  1. Open Onboarding. The Overview lists every submitted brief with its Project, Status, Client and the date it was submitted.
  2. Click a row to open the brief.

Note — A brief appears here only while it's awaiting review; once you decide on it, it leaves the queue.

Review a brief

Decide whether a submitted project can be onboarded.

  1. From the queue, open the brief. It shows the customer's answers — the project goal, whether it's international, the target audience and its size, the desired features, references and notes — plus the SaaS level they were assigned.

Organize a validated project

  1. Open OnboardingOrganize. The queue lists validated projects with their plan, infrastructure, feature count, region, domain and terms status.
  2. Click a row to open the organizer.
  3. Work through its sections — SaaS type, Infrastructure and Features are yours to set; Localization, Domain and Terms are filled in by the customer and shown read-only.

Set the plan and hosting

  1. In the organizer, under SaaS type, click Add SaaS type, pick a level and click Save (use Edit or Remove to change it).
  2. Under Infrastructure, click Add infrastructure, pick a tier — Shared, Standard or Advanced — and click Save.

The plan and hosting are recorded on the project.

Note — Setting or changing the plan or hosting clears its validation, which must be in place before the project can launch.

Add the project's features

  1. In the organizer, under Features, click Add feature.
  2. Enter a feature name and a description.
  3. Click Add.

The feature is added to the list. Use Edit or Delete on each feature to change it.

Launch the project

Commission a fully organized project so it goes live.

  1. Open the project in the organizer.
  2. When every required element is complete — the plan, the hosting, at least one feature, the customer's region, a verified domain and accepted terms — the Ready to launch box appears.
  3. Click Launch organization.

The project is commissioned and a confirmation replaces the box.

NoteLaunch organization appears only once every required element is complete; until then, finish the missing parts — yours or the customer's. Launching commissions the project; provisioning its infrastructure is handled separately by our team.
